Excerpt from Studies in the Christian Evidences: Being Apologetics for the Times The particular position taken up in the book is to be carefully noted. It starts from Theism, or the belief in a personal God, as its accepted basis. Its design is to aid in removing obstacles out of the way, and in con ducting the earnest reader from the position of Theism into the central truths of the Christian religion, and a reasonable faith therein. Excerpt from Studies in the Christian Evidences: Being Apologetics for the Times This book is not written primarily for professional students, whether theological or scientific, though it is hoped that even readers of this class may find it not altogether uninteresting or unworthy of their notice. It is written expressly for that section of our intelligent Church members and adherents whose minds have been brought into contact with the religious doubts and difficulties of the age, and have in some measure felt them; and not less for those who, as Christian teachers and counsellors, are called on from time to time to deal with such doubts and difficulties as they arise in the minds of others. The special design of the book has to a great degree determined its character. It is not meant to be a "System of Christian Evidences"; for, as a rule, such treatises, from their very nature, are far too minute and full for the readers in view. Dr Francis S. Collins, head of the Human Genome Project, is one of the world's leading scientists, working at the cutting edge of the study of DNA, the code of life. Yet he is also a man of unshakable faith in God. How does he reconcile the seemingly unreconcilable? In THE LANGUAGE OF GOD he explains his own journey from atheism to faith, and then takes the reader on a stunning tour of modern science to show that physics, chemistry and biology -- indeed, reason itself -- are not incompatible with belief. His book is essential reading for anyone who wonders about the deepest questions of all: why are we here? How did we get here? And what does life mean?
